Surrounded by extraordinary people, inspiring leaders, and world changing projects, you will do more and become more than you ever thought possible.Position Summary:Illumina Laboratory Services (ILS) is seeking a Clinical Laboratory Technician to join our Singapore-based clinical genomics laboratory. This is a hands-on, laboratory-based role at the cutting edge of clinical genomics, supporting the delivery of high-quality genomic testing to patients across the region.In this role, you will perform a range of laboratory techniques in compliance with ISO 15189 quality standards, including DNA extraction, DNA quantification, library preparation, and next-generation sequencing using the NovaSeq X Plus platform. You will work with a combination of automated workflows (e.g., Hamilton STAR systems) and manual bench-top assays, gaining broad exposure to modern clinical laboratory operations. You will also play an important role in maintaining a safe, organized, and compliant laboratory environment.This is an entry-level position suited to someone eager to learn, develop technical expertise, and grow within a regulated clinical laboratory setting.
